The Radcliffe Animal Shelter was set up over 40 years ago to find dogs, cats and miscellaneous animals loving and permanent homes.
Many of the animals are brought in to us as unwanted and, through no fault of their own, they suddenly find themselves in entirely unfamiliar surroundings, thinking what have they done wrong to deserve this? It may be that their owners are moving house and do not want to take them; they have a new baby in the family and feel the pet may become jealous; their working commitments make it impossible to give the pet enough attention; or they simply cannot cope.
Giving a home to one of these animals is one of the most rewarding experiences especially when the first few weeks or months may not be entirely trouble free! If often takes them several weeks to settle in and feel secure in their new home. Many of our animals may have developed behavioural problems just as a result of the stress they have suffered and it takes a very special person to see beyond this stage.
